Circuit/System Testing

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2009 Saturn Vue.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Ignition OFF, disconnect low speed fan relay, which is FAN AUX relay.
  2. Ignition ON, observe that both fans are now OFF.
    • If both fans are OFF, replace low speed relay. If either fan is still activated, remove high speed fan relay, which is FAN MAIN relay. If both fans are now OFF, replace high speed relay. If either fan is still activated, test for a short to voltage in the fan voltage supply circuit.
